How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Poplar?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Poplar Studio Apartments | $1,777 | $830 | $5,300 |
Poplar 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,232 | $500 | $6,292 |
Poplar 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,462 | $499 | $10,000+ |
Poplar 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,523 | $599 | $9,670 |
Poplar 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,062 | $585 | $10,000+ |
Poplar 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,573 | $1,800 | $3,250 |
Poplar 6 Bedroom Apartments | $3,095 | $600 | $4,500 |
